::I assume you're using Audacity? There should be a small drop-down menu on the top-left of each track. Click on it and go to "Set Sample Format". Click on "16-bit PCM". You can also export Audacity projects as OGG files, without the hassle of going through a file converter (and they all claim to be the best... it's so annoying). Also, just wanted to add that we usually pick a 30 second sample from the track and use that. It's easier said than done, but try to pick the catchiest 30-second part of the song. --'''[[:User:K6ka|k6ka]]''' ([[:User talk:K6ka|talk]] | [[:Special:Contributions/K6ka|contribs]]) 02:31, September 16, 2014 (UTC)
